Chapter 657 — Unemployment Insurance
ORS 657.785 Agreement for Interstate Reciprocal Overpayment Recovery Arrangement
The Director of the Employment Department may enter into an agreement or agreements with any other state’s employment security agency, or group thereof, including the Interstate Reciprocal Overpayment Recovery Arrangement, for the mutual and reciprocal recovery of overpaid unemployment compensation benefits. Notwithstanding any other provision of this chapter, the director may withhold from benefits otherwise due amounts necessary to recover overpaid benefits on behalf of other states with which the director has entered into such mutual and reciprocal agreements.
For purposes of this section, “states” includes the District of Columbia, Puerto Rico and the Virgin Islands.
